    Hydrophobic Interaction Columns


    Hydrophobic Interaction Chromatography (HIC) separates proteins by mechanisms similar to Reversed-Phase Chromatography but under gentle reverse salt gradient elution conditions in aqueous buffers. Since no organic solvent is used, biological activity has a much higher probability of being retained.

    HYDROCELL C3 1500, C4 1500 and Phenyl 1500 are prepared from 10 µm particles of hydrophilic PS-DVB beads with pore diameter of 500 Å. Similarly, C3 3000, C4 3000 and Phenyl 3000 are produced from 10 µm particles of hydrophilic, macroporous PS-DVB beads with average pore diameter of 1500Å.

    The packing materials have been chemically bonded with allyl (C3), butyl (C4) or phenyl as a hydrophobic group. These packings are the same as HYDROCELL ion exchange packings which do not have any weak ester linkages as do the other commercial products. They are stable in a pH range of 1 to 14 and are compatible with most organic solvents. The columns can be operated at high flow rates for rapid equilibration and fast clean-up.

    The dynamic protein loading capacity determined by Frontal Uptake procedures are about 30 mg, 30 mg and 35 mg of lysozyme per mL of column volume on C3 1500, C4 1500 and Phenyl 1500 respectively. The practical loading capacity is about 0.4 - 0.6 mg of protein on a 50 x 4.6mm column. For detailed chromatograms on each packing material, please click the following:
